What is legally required to ensure proper disposal of pesticides?

The legally required practice for the proper disposal of pesticides includes both the pesticide and its container. This is essential because pesticides can pose significant environmental and health risks if not disposed of correctly. The pesticide itself is hazardous, and its container may still contain residues that are also harmful. Therefore, both components must be managed properly to prevent contamination and ensure safety.

Additionally, regulations are in place to enforce the safe handling and disposal of both the substance and its packaging material. This includes ensuring that containers are emptied and cleaned before disposal, as residues can still be dangerous. Not addressing both the pesticide and its container could lead to potential environmental hazards or violations of legal regulations.
